Title:
METHOD OF SIMULTANEOUSLY RECOVERING LITHIUM SALT FOR ELECTROLYTE AND ORGANIC SOLVENT FROM WASTE ELECTROLYTE, AND DEVICE THEREFOR

Abstract:
PROBLEM TO BE SOLVED: To provide a method of simultaneously recovering lithium salt for electrolyte appropriately recyclable for a lithium battery and/or a lithium ion battery, and an organic solvent, and to provide a device capable of implementing the method.SOLUTION: A waste electrolyte containing an organic solvent and lithium salt which is an electrolyte of a lithium battery and/or a lithium ion battery is heated/condensed by an evaporator 2 to crystallize lithium salt. At the same time, when condensing and recovering the organic solvent evaporated by the evaporator in a condenser 3, the evaporator and the condenser are communicated with each other into one sealable system, the waste electrolyte is heated and the organic solvent is evaporated in the evaporator 2 while controlling a quantity of non-condensed gas in the condenser to be exhausted to a system outside 91 by means of exhaust means 16 provided in the condenser and capable of exhausting non-condensed gas outside of the system, to 5 mass% or less with respect to the initial quantity. The organic solvent evaporated by the evaporator 2 is condensed in the condenser 3.
